摘要:蜘蛛程序是一种自动化工具,用于从互联网上抓取信息并存储在数据库中。含笑九拳将介绍蜘蛛程序的下载方式及其应用场景。
一、什么是蜘蛛程序?
二、如何下载蜘蛛程序?
1. 开源软件
2. 商业软件
三、蜘蛛程序的应用场景
1. 竞品分析
2. 数据挖掘
3. SEO优化
四、如何使用蜘蛛程序?
五、注意事项
一、什么是蜘蛛程序?
在互联网上,我们经常需要从各种网站上获取数据。手动去抓取这些数据是非常费时费力的,人们开发出了自动化工具——“爬虫(Spider)”,也称为“网络爬虫(Web Crawler)”或“网络机器人(Web Robot)”。
爬虫通过模拟浏览器行为,自动访问指定的网站,并从页面中提取出需要的信息。这些信息可以是文字、图片、视频等多种形式。爬虫将这些信息存储在数据库中,供后续分析和处理。
其中,“蜘蛛程序(Spider)”是一种特殊的爬虫。它的工作方式类似于蜘蛛在网上爬行,从一个网页到另一个网页,不断地抓取信息。蜘蛛程序也被称为“网络蜘蛛(Web Spider)”或“网络爬行器(Web Crawler)”。
二、如何下载蜘蛛程序?
目前市面上有很多开源和商业的蜘蛛程序可供下载。下面介绍两种常见的下载方式。
1. 开源软件
开源软件是指可以免费获取和使用的软件,其源代码也是公开的。开源软件通常具有高度的灵活性和可定制性。
常见的开源爬虫框架包括Scrapy、Beautiful Soup、PySpider等。这些框架都提供了丰富的API和插件,可以方便地实现各种功能。
2. 商业软件
商业软件通常具有更加完善的功能和技术支持,并且在性能和稳定性方面也更为优秀。
市面上比较知名的商业爬虫框架包括Apify、Diffbot、Octoparse等。这些框架提供了图形化界面,使得使用者可以轻松地配置任务并执行爬取操作。
三、蜘蛛程序的应用场景
蜘蛛程序可以应用于各种领域,下面列举了三个常见的应用场景。
1. 竞品分析
企业可以利用蜘蛛程序抓取竞品网站上的信息,例如产品价格、销量、评价等。通过对这些数据的分析和比较,企业可以了解竞争对手的优劣势,并制定相应的营销策略。
2. 数据挖掘
大量的数据被存储在互联网上,而这些数据对于企业和研究人员来说都具有重要价值。利用蜘蛛程序可以自动化地抓取这些数据,并进行分析和挖掘。例如,可以抓取社交媒体上用户发布的内容,并进行情感分析、主题分类等。
3. SEO优化
搜索引擎优化(SEO)是指通过优化网站结构、内容和外部链接等方式,提高网站在搜索引擎结果页面中的排名。蜘蛛程序可以帮助SEO专家快速地抓取和分析目标网站上的关键词、内部链接等信息,并据此进行优化。
四、如何使用蜘蛛程序?
使用蜘蛛程序需要具备一定的编程知识和技能。下面简要介绍一些使用蜘蛛程序的步骤。
1. 确定目标网站:首先需要确定需要抓取的目标网站,并了解其页面结构和数据格式。
2. 编写爬虫代码:根据目标网站的页面结构,编写相应的爬虫代码。这些代码通常使用Python或Java等编程语言实现。
3. 运行爬虫程序:将编写好的爬虫程序运行起来,开始自动化地抓取目标网站上的数据。
4. 存储数据:将抓取到的数据存储在数据库中,供后续分析和处理。
五、注意事项
在使用蜘蛛程序时需要注意以下几点:
1. 遵守法律法规:在抓取数据时需要遵守相关法律法规,不得侵犯他益。
2. 尊重网站隐私:不要在未经允许的情况下抓取个人信息等敏感数据。
3. 控制抓取频率:过于频繁地抓取会给目标网站带来负担,甚至可能导致被封禁。需要控制抓取频率,避免对目标网站造成影响。
4. 处理异常情况:在抓取过程中可能会遇到各种异常情况,例如页面不存在、网络超时等。需要对这些异常情况进行处理,保证程序的稳定性和可靠性。
蜘蛛程序是一种非常有用的自动化工具,可以帮助我们快速地获取互联网上的信息。但在使用时需要注意合法合规、尊重隐私等原则,以免造成不良后果。
蜘蛛程序下载获取地址如下:
素材兔作者@含笑九拳分享关于蜘蛛程序下载的全部内容,感谢你的阅读与支持!